Q: Is 514,621,161 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 514,621,161 is a composite number.

Why is 514,621,161 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 514,621,161 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 17 27 51 153 459 1,121,179 3,363,537 10,090,611 19,060,043 30,271,833 57,180,129 171,540,387 and 514,621,161, with no remainder.

Since 514,621,161 cannot be divided by just 1 and 514,621,161, it is a composite number.
